Key Challenges and Controversies:
One of the primary challenges facing the adoption of novel diagnostic testing methods is the potential for regulatory hurdles and reimbursement issues. As the landscape evolves with cutting-edge solutions, ensuring universal access to these tests while navigating complex regulatory frameworks poses a significant hurdle. Additionally, concerns regarding data privacy and the ethical implications of genetic testing in gastrointestinal health diagnostics are subjects that warrant critical analysis.

Advantages and Disadvantages:
The advantages of revolutionizing gastrointestinal health diagnostics are manifold, encompassing early detection of diseases, tailored treatment strategies, and improved patient outcomes. By leveraging state-of-the-art technologies, healthcare providers can offer more precise and timely interventions, thereby enhancing the overall quality of care. However, the rapid pace of innovation also brings about challenges such as the need for continuous training of healthcare professionals to interpret complex diagnostic outputs accurately and the risk of overreliance on technology at the expense of holistic patient care.
